1. The Workings of an Off-Grid Solar System

An off-grid solar system consists of three main components: solar panels, a battery bank, and an inverter. Solar panels generate electricity by capturing sunlight and converting it into direct current (DC) electricity. The battery bank, usually composed of Lithium batteries, stores the surplus solar-generated power for use when the panels are not producing energy, such as nighttime or cloudy days.

Inverters are essential for transforming the stored DC power into alternating current (AC) power, which is compatible with standard household appliances. As part of a complete off-grid solar solution, the inverter also regulates the flow of energy between the solar panels, battery bank, and the connected appliances, ensuring an uninterrupted supply of electricity.

Together, these components create an independent and efficient power source that enables homeowners to be self-reliant, shielded from fluctuations in electricity prices, and immune to grid power shortages or failures.

2. Financial Benefits of Going Off-Grid

One of the most significant and immediate advantages of going off-grid is the potential for long-term cost savings. As an off-grid solar system eliminates the need for purchasing electricity from utility providers, homeowners can avoid ever-increasing electricity prices and reduce their monthly energy bills. Any upfront costs associated with equipment and installation can be offset within a few years, depending on the size of the system and household consumption patterns.

Going off-grid may also provide financial incentives in the form of government rebates, subsidies, or grants, further reducing the initial investment costs. Moreover, if you are starting on a clean slate – such as building a new home – installing an off-grid solar system can be more cost-effective than connecting to the grid, particularly in remote locations where grid connection costs may be high.

4. Preparing for the Off-Grid Lifestyle

Living off the grid can be a rewarding and sustainable lifestyle choice. However, it requires ample preparation and an understanding of your household energy needs. Carefully assessing your daily energy consumption, as well as peak usage periods, allows you to configure an adequately designed off-grid solar system tailored to your unique requirements.

Establishing energy-efficient practices and embracing energy-saving appliances can further maximise the effectiveness of your off-grid solar system. Integrating regular system maintenance, monitoring, and timely upgrades will ensure your off-grid solar system remains efficient, dependable, and capable of delivering long-term benefits.
